The Outsider Posted March 20, 2011 Posted March 20, 2011 It's a batsman's game, but Zaheer has carried the Indian bowling basically on his own. 15 wickets, an average of 15, and ER of 4.3. Not just the numbers it's been the timing of his wickets - brought India back into the match against England when we had lost for all practical purposes, the death bowling against South Africa to give Nehra a very defendable total, and again Smith's wicket against WI. For me he has been India's MVP.
